Choking emergencies are typically caused by the obstruction of the airway, often due to food items like hard candies, nuts, or large pieces of meat. Other potential causes include small objects, such as toys or coins, especially in young children. Certain medical conditions or disabilities that affect swallowing can also increase the risk of choking. Prompt recognition and intervention are crucial to prevent serious outcomes.
